Council reviews request to vacate portion of Mitchell Street tree-preservation easement, debate over canopy replacement and precedent

Fayetteville City Council · April 8, 2024

Summary

City staff recommended conditional approval to vacate about 0.14 acres of a tree preservation easement on West Mitchell Street in exchange for approximately 0.8 acres of replacement easements elsewhere; council members raised concerns about precedent for vacating permanent easements, canopy locations, past tree removal and requested a fuller presentation next week.
